Telemetry Update: New kbc_non_sql_workspace Tables & Deprecation of Legacy Telemetry Tables

We are introducing two new telemetry tables — kbc_non_sql_workspace and kbc_non_sql_workspace_run — that unify metadata and consumption tracking for all non-SQL workspaces (Data Apps and Data Science sandboxes). Several legacy tables are being deprecated and will be retired at the end of May 2026.

Telemetry Update: New kbc_sql_workspace Table

We are introducing a new dedicated table, kbc_sql_workspace, available at both project and organization level. This table is specifically designed for SQL Workspaces (Snowflake/BigQuery-based) and replaces the SQL Workspace data previously served by kbc_workspace.

Changelog: Snowflake Billing Update (effective April 2, 2026)

Starting April 2, 2026, a new billing breakdown "Query Service" is introduced for Snowflake query billing.

New "Refund" Usage Breakdown for Exceptional Credit Adjustments

We’re introducing a new refund usage breakdown to transparently adjust credit consumption in rare cases affected by platform-side technical issues.
